24 hours ago, Jun's POV
『Really now...』
Upon exiting the basement through the elevator, as far as I could see was a horde of zombies and B.O.Ws. The forest that once stood tall was gone and replaced by a cracked, barren land. Further in the distance was a large crater and destroyed buildings surrounding it. What happened since our short departure? Another war? With who?
These thoughts were useless right because the horde ahead of me was walking in my direction. There was a conspicuous B.O.W that was in the center of this horde, surrounded by larger and stronger B.O.Ws. I guessed he was the commander of these B.O.Ws but failed to control the Virus and thus turned as well. The man also noticed me and commanded the horde to attack.
The fight began mostly with me having the advantage, but slowly and surely I was being pushed back by the sheer number of them. This, of course, lasted for the whole day and night until I managed to kill and eat the man's upper body. What I thought would stop the B.O.Ws was the complete opposite, as they started to rapidly mutate and evolve into giant, twisted, tentacled monsters. I also received an evolution prompt but I didn't have the leisure to evolve right now in front of the enemy.
Twin's POV
The first thing she witnessed upon leaving the Rift was Jun's bloody figure fighting with a tentacled monster covered in metallic spikes. All around us was pure destruction of what was once an Umbrella Facility. It wasn't just the tentacled monster that Jun was fighting though. As far as the eye could see, hordes of zombies and B.O.Ws encircled, and what was once a flourishing town after the Civil war ended, now turned to ruins.

Juno dashed from the ruins and jumped on Jun's back and viciously leaped at the tentacled monster's head. Jun took this time to retreat and take a breather for a moment, watching as Juno's figure gracefully danced around the tentacles that flew towards her. Slashing and biting everything she could see, the tentacled monster was shredded to pieces and dropped to the ground with a thud.
『Jun, are you okay?』 (Juno)
『It's not dead yet』 (Jun)
The once motionless monster wriggled its tentacles and absorbed the nearby B.O.Ws growing larger and stronger.
『Juno, give me a few minutes』 (Jun)
Her response was a quick dash towards the monster. Avoiding the tentacles just barely, which proved useful for a while until the tentacles started to mutate once again. Taking this moment of its defenseless self, she decapitated many of its tentacles, showering herself in black blood mixed with squirming worms that tried to drill into her. It was useless though.
Juno avoided the incoming tentacle that was aiming for her head but the end of its attack was yet to come. Needles burst out from the tentacle which grazed her skin as it was pulled back. Although surprised, she wasn't worried one bit. Thanks to her much harder exoskeleton only tiny scratches lined her body but was healed pretty fast.
However, she didn't lower her guard at all since more of these monsters were forming in the distance. Smaller and less dangerous of course, but was still an annoyance. Juns evolution wasn't over yet, which was abnormally long considering their past evolutions. She continued to slice off the tentacles until the other monsters had finally entered range to attack her.
Finding herself surrounded by the monsters, she only managed to dodge the smaller tentacles but was caught by the larger one. The tentacles wrapped around her constricted her body with the long needles grinding against her skin, eventually puncturing the armor.

『Thanks, Juno』 (Jun)
The constricting tentacle stopped its actions and loosened up, dropping her figure to the ground. The other B.O.Ws stopped and motionlessly stood at their spot, staring at Jun.
『Jun, you...』 (Juno)
Jun's figure had steam coming off of his body. His chest had risen slightly and turned a charred black, rocky appearance with red cracks spreading outwards from the center that was glowing an orange-red, thumping loudly. His forearms had the same appearance as his chest with longer and sharper claws.
『Go. Kill everything.』 (Jun)
The B.O.Ws obeyed his command and left the ruined facility, leaving behind two aliens sitting outside the Rift Gate.
『Jun』 (Juno)
『Let's go』 (Jun)
『Yeah』 (Juno)
